Overview:
We are seeking a highly motivated Embedded Software Engineer to join the Consumer Electronics Software Platform team at TP-Link Systems Inc.
In this position, you will design, implement, and optimize embedded software core function on our platforms.
You’ll ensure the functions meet the reliability and performance needs of various smart home products and is compatible with peripherals and cloud interfaces.
You will work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ure that our features meet the highest standards of user experience and bring amazing Smart Home products to the market.
Key Responsibilities:
+ Participate in Developing next generation software platform with first-class performance and reliability
+ Maintain and optimize current software platform of embedded Linux and RTOS
+ Responsible for identifying and resolving platform issues at all stages of the project lifecycle.
+ Participate in core module (A/V transmission, control, networking, connectivity, storage, etc.) design, development and troubleshooting.
+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define system requirements and design effective solutions.
+ Write, debug, and test software for embedded systems using C/C++ and other relevant programming languages.
+ Use cross-compiling methods to integrate third-party functionalities.
+ Troubleshoot and resolve complex issues in embedded systems
+ Conduct unit testing, integration testing, and system validation for embedded systems.
+ Ensure that software is safe, reliable, and meets all performance standards, including security protocols to protect against potential vulnerabilities.
+ Optimize code to meet performance, memory, and power efficiency requirements.
+ Work with version control systems (e.g., Git) and development tools for continuous integration.
+ Provide technical documentation, including design specifications, software architecture, and user manuals.
+ Collaborate with external vendors and third-party partners to efficiently integrate hardware and software components.
+ Stay updated on emerging trends and technologies in embedded systems, IoT, and connectivity protocols to continuously improve product features and performance.
+ Mentor and guide recent graduates, providing technical leadership and sharing best practices through code reviews and team collaboration.
Requirements
Required Qualifications:
+ Bachelor's degree in computer science, Electrical Engineering, or a related field.
+ 3+years of experience working with embedded software.
+ Proficiency in embedded software programming using C/C++, with a strong understanding of coding best practices.
+ Experience with core software module design
+ Familiarity with embedded operating systems (e.g., RTOS, Linux) and real-time system design.
+ Experience with microcontrollers, processors, and hardware interfaces such as UART, SPI, I2C, and GPIO.
+ Experience with network and security protocols in embedded systems (e.g., HTTP, MQTT, TLS, encryption algorithms).
+ Understanding of software development life cycle, including version control, unit testing, and continuous integration.
+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
+ Ability to work independently and within a team in a fast-paced environment.
Preferred Qualifications:
+ Experience with development of consumer electronics products such as IPC, Doorbell, Hub and Smart Home devices.
+ Experience in the bottom layers of the storage software stack (Filesystem, Block Device, SSD)
+ Experience in resolving performance bottlenecks in resource (CPU, Memory) constrained Platforms and devices.
+ Proven track record with embedded Wi-Fi, Bluetooth/BLE and TCP/IP Networking software
+ Strong communication, interpersonal, and project leadership skills.
+ Ability to quickly adapt to new technologies and frameworks.
+ Knowledge of power optimization techniques for embedded devices.
